小编MVS*_*ath的帖子

单括号和双括号Numpy数组有什么区别?

import numpy as np
a=np.random.randn(1, 2)
b=np.zeros((1,2))
print("Data type of A: ",type(a))
print("Data type of A: ",type(b))
Run Code Online (Sandbox Code Playgroud)

输出:

Data type of A:  <class 'numpy.ndarray'>
Data type of A:  <class 'numpy.ndarray'>
Run Code Online (Sandbox Code Playgroud)

在np.zeros()中,要声明一个数组,我们在2个方括号中给出输入,而在np.random.radn()中,在1个方括号中给出输入?

语法是否有任何特定原因,因为它们都是相同的数据类型,但是遵循不同的语法?

python arrays numpy

3
推荐指数
1
解决办法
879
查看次数

标签 统计

arrays ×1

numpy ×1

python ×1